noun, noun or participle which takes 'suru', intransitive verb
working in the field in fine weather and reading at home in rainy weather; living in quiet retirement dividing time between work and intellectual pursuits
A yojijukugo describing an ideal of a simple, self-sufficient life balanced between physical labor and study. Often used to evoke a pastoral, scholarly retirement.
祖父は田舎で晴耕雨読の生活を送っている。
My grandfather leads a life of working in the fields when it's sunny and reading when it rains in the countryside.
After retirement, I want to spend my days in quiet retirement, dividing time between work and intellectual pursuits.
